<p>Based on my speed and rev rate, I expected the <a href='http://www.bowlingball.com/brunswick-anaconda-bowling-ball.html' target='bowlingball.com'>Brunswick Anaconda</a> to match up well for me because of the polished coverstock. I seem to throw polished bowling balls better because that helps me get the ball further down the lane. This <a target="_blank" href="http://www.bowlingball.com/bowling-balls.html">bowling ball</a> was very smooth, controllable, and the color combination worked well for my eyes to see the motion.</p>
<p>You can see in the <a target="_blank" href="http://www.bowlingball.com/brunswick-anaconda-bowling-ball.html?video=1">bowling ball reaction video</a> that I had a lot of area at the break point. If you watch the video, you can see me swing it out to about board 7 on one shot and tug it to only about 13 on another, and both gave me great looks into the pocket. </p>

<b>Activator Plus Coverstock</b><br />
The Anaconda is the first ball with Activator Plus coverstock available at the Advanced Performance price point. Activator Plus is a more aggressive version of the original Activator coverstock formulation that maintains the durability and longevity of ball reaction that are characteristic of the Activator coverstock family. The rough-buff, pearlized version of Activator Plus coverstock used on the Anaconda creates more traction in the oil, increasing the ball's mid-lane and back-end hooking action, while still being clean through the front-end.<br />
<br />
<b>Ultra Low RG Inferno Core</b><br />
The Anaconda uses an updated version of the Original Inferno core. The Ultra Low RG Inferno core revs quickly providing mid-lane traction control with a strong predictable back-end motion.<br />
<br />
<b>Ball Motion</b><br />
With its Rough Buff finish, the Anaconda will rev quickly in the mid-lane with a strong continuous back-end reaction that matches up on medium to medium-oily lane conditions for a wide range of bowling styles.<br />
<br />
<b>Reaction Setup</b><br />
The Anaconda can be drilled using the standard drilling techniques developed for symmetric bowling balls.<br />
<br />
<b>Lightweight Engineering</b><br />
The unique core shape of each Brunswick ball is used for weights from 14 to 16 pounds. This approach to lightweight ball engineering provides bowlers with consistent ball reaction characteristics across this weight range. The same drilling instructions can be used for 12- and 13-pound balls. This is because Brunswick uses a generic core shape with an RG differential that is close enough to the 14-16 pound shape.</p>

<p><strong>Coverstock</strong><br />
Activator Solid Coverstock: The Diamondback™ is the first ball with Activator Solid coverstock available at the Advanced Performance price point. The original Activator coverstock used on the Diamondback is a proven formula that provides strong downlane recovery, longevity of ball reaction, and unprecedented durability with superior resistance to cracking.</p>
<p><strong>Core</strong></p>
<p><strong>Low RG Rocket Core:</strong><br />
The Diamondback uses the proven Brunswick multi-sided Rocket™ core system, providing a low RG core that when combined with the original Activator coverstock produces a ball reaction that is unmatched at the Advanced Performance price point. Clean through the front with an aggressive move at the breakpoint, the Diamondback gives amazing bang for the buck. There isn&#8217;t another ball in this class that&#8217;s even close.</p>
<p><strong>Reaction Characteristics</strong></p>
<p><strong>Ball Motion:</strong><br />
With its 2,000 Siaair Micro Pad finish, the Diamondback will provide good length with a strong continuous backend reaction that matches up on medium to oily lane conditions for a wide range of bowling styles.</p>
<p><strong>Reaction Setup:</strong><br />
The Diamondback can be drilled using the standard drilling techniques developed for symmetric bowling balls.</p>

		<script src="http://digg.com/tools/diggthis.js" type="text/javascript"></script></div><p>I had a typically boy upbringing, not saying it was right, but I was told big boys don&#8217;t cry.&nbsp; To this day, it takes a lot for me to show emotion (to my wife&#8217;s dismay).&nbsp; This is a preamble to what happened at the end of my vacation.</p>
<p>My parents divorced when I was seven or eight and my mother felt the need to move us to Florida.&nbsp; I understand that it was because she had family in Florida that could help her and us three kids.&nbsp; It wouldn&#8217;t be until many many many years later that I realized that my father had no idea that was coming.&nbsp; He never mentioned it when we would visit and he never spoke ill of my mother.&nbsp; Quite the contrary on the other hand.</p>
<p>During my trip to see him in August 2009, we were sitting in his living room when he said I have something I want to give you and if I don&#8217;t do it now I will forget.&nbsp; I had no clue what it could be.&nbsp; He stood up and started rummaging through a little cabinet and pulled out a very old photo album.&nbsp; He scanned through it and found an old photo from a photo booth of him and my mom.&nbsp; I am pretty sure my mom destroyed any pictures she may have had of him, so this was very precious to me and a very welcomed surprise.&nbsp; We then looked through some of the other photos of him at a very tough time.&nbsp; He was in Vietnam and of course looked much different than he does today.</p>
<p>On the day I got home from vacation, I called to let him know I arrived safely and to thank him again for the picture.&nbsp; We had a great talk and at the end he told me he was proud of me.&nbsp; I think that may be the first time I have heard that from him.&nbsp; We hung up moments later and I sat on the couch very happy with tears in my eyes.&nbsp; I sat with it for a couple of minutes and then got up to do some chores in the kitchen.</p>
<p>I continued to think about it and had more tears come to me.&nbsp; At that time my wife had come out of the bedroom, and I just couldn&#8217;t hold them back.&nbsp; I was full out crying, she was terrified that something horrible had happened, and I was trying to tell her everything was ok, but I just couldn&#8217;t get the words out.&nbsp; She hugged me for a minute or so until I could mutter the words, &#8220;He told me he was proud of me&#8230;&#8221;</p>
<p>Thank you dad!&nbsp; </p>
